No. 8-ranked Metro State Falls to Holy Family, 56-55, in Hawaii

Nov. 26, 2005

Box Score

HILO, HAWAII -- Ryan Haigh hit a jumper with six seconds remaining to lift Holy Family to a 56-55 upset of No. 6-ranked Metro State in the Hawaii-Hilo Shootout Friday night at Civic Auditorium.

The Roadrunners were led by Dustin Ballard with 12 points, while Hayden Smith and Drew Williamson each scored 11. Williamson added five assists, while Moussa Coulibaly pulled down a game-high 11 rebounds.

Metro State, which led by one at the half, committed 19 turnovers and shot just 37.5 percent (18-for-48) from the floor. The Roadrunners were also 0-for-8 from three-point land in the first half. Although they went 15-for-17 from the line in the game, the Roadrunners attempted just four free throws in the second half of the contest.

With the win, Holy Family improves to 2-1, while Metro State falls to 2-1. The Roadrunners play Hawaii-Hilo Saturday night at 7:30 p.m., Hawaii time (10:30 p.m., MST).
